Deletion of a file normally does not result in any registry modifications
whatsoever! When you delete a file, changes are made to the directory
entries and the space allocation tables on your disk partition. That should
be it. Taking "several minutes just to delete a 2KB file using Windows
Explorer" is indicative of other major problems with your particular
computer system, possible corruption of your disk directories and
allocation tables and/or disk fragmentation.
